In the confrontation between Brazilians for the round of 16 of Roland Garros, one of the four main tournaments of the World Tennis (the Grand Slams), Orlando Luz was the best. This Sunday (1st), the partnership between the gaucho, number 64 of the pair ranking of the Association of Professional Tennis players (ATP), and Croatian Ivan Dodig (58th), beat the carioca Fernando Romboli (56th) with Australian John-Patrick Smith (62º) by 2 sets to 1.
The partials were 4/6, 7/6 (7-5 in tie-break) and 6/4, in two hours and 20 minutes of departure. The result ranked light and Dodig for the quarterfinals of the tournament’s men’s doubles key, played in Paris, France. They will face Spaniard Marcel Granollers (10th) and Argentine Horacio Zeballos (11th) in the next phase, worth the semifinals. The match will still be marked by the organization.

In addition to Luz, Brazil has Paulistas Beatriz Haddad Maia and Luísa Stefani with chances of title in Roland Garros.
The partnership of Bia, number 44 of the doubles ranking of the Women’s Tennis Association (WTA), with the German Laura Siegemund (25th), faces this Monday (2), from 7:30 am (Brasília time), the Italian Jasmine Paolini (4th) and Sara Errani (6th).
Later, Luisa (31) and Hungarian Timea Babos (27th) face the two best-placed players in the WTA female ranking: Czech Katerine Siniakova (1st) and the American Taylor Townsend (2nd). If they advance, the Brazilian would be only in an eventual final.
